https://bugs.winehq.org/show_bug.cgi?id=48093
Bug ID: 48093 Summary: On cw-rx460 the WoW WinePrefixes are (likely) broken Product: Wine-Testbot Version: unspecified Hardware: x86 OS: Linux Status: NEW Severity: normal Priority: P2 Component: unknown Assignee: wine-bugs@winehq.org Reporter: fgouget@codeweavers.com Distribution: ---
On cw-rx460 the wineprefixes created for the wow32 and wow64 test runs are flawed:
* It looks like they do not define the %windir% and %SystemRoot% environment variables: https://www.winehq.org/pipermail/wine-devel/2019-October/152271.html
* They may be responsible for a failure in crypt32:sip https://www.winehq.org/pipermail/wine-devel/2019-November/154240.html
What's puzzling is that cw-rx460 runs the same wt-daily script (*) as cw-gtx560 and other machines which don't have the same set of failures (see also bug 48092).
cw-rx460 is not a TestBot VM so this does not impact the TestBot results. But if the wineprefixes are indeed causing extra test failures this could lead developers on a wild goose chase. So to avoid confusion I disabled the wow32 and wow64 WineTest runs on that machine until I have had time to investigate.
(*) https://github.com/fgouget/wt-daily
https://bugs.winehq.org/show_bug.cgi?id=48093
François Gouget fgouget@codeweavers.com changed:
What |Removed |Added ---------------------------------------------------------------------------- Resolution|--- |WORKSFORME Status|NEW |RESOLVED
--- Comment #1 from François Gouget fgouget@codeweavers.com --- The wow32 and wow64 test runs have been reenabled on cw-rx460.
crypt32:sip does not have any failures despite still using %windir%: https://test.winehq.org/data/tests/crypt32:sip.html
According to a quick test both the %windir% and %SystemRoot% environment variables are defined when running a 32-bit executable from either the wow32 or wow64 build trees.
Since things now seem to be working fine I'm closing this bug.
https://bugs.winehq.org/show_bug.cgi?id=48093
Austin English austinenglish@gmail.com changed:
What |Removed |Added ---------------------------------------------------------------------------- Status|RESOLVED |CLOSED
--- Comment #2 from Austin English austinenglish@gmail.com --- Closing.
https://bugs.winehq.org/show_bug.cgi?id=48093
Austin English austinenglish@gmail.com changed:
What |Removed |Added ---------------------------------------------------------------------------- Status|CLOSED |RESOLVED
--- Comment #3 from Austin English austinenglish@gmail.com --- Closing.
https://bugs.winehq.org/show_bug.cgi?id=48093
François Gouget fgouget@codeweavers.com changed:
What |Removed |Added ---------------------------------------------------------------------------- Status|RESOLVED |CLOSED
--- Comment #4 from François Gouget fgouget@codeweavers.com --- Closing.